Oregon put the cherry on top of their solid recruiting class Wednesday as Villanova graduate-transfer Dylan Ennis committed to the school.

Ennis started all 36 games for Villanova last season, averaging 9.9 points per game along with 3.7 rebounds and 3.5 assists. He will bring experience and leadership to a young Oregon team.
This is Ennis' second transfer of his career, as he originally began at Rice.
He will likely be the opening night starter for the Ducks.
